And he proposed Marvel Snap Nuzlocke. Are either of you familiar with a Nuzlocke? No. No. i I heard about it, and I'm like, I think that's the name of a Pokemon. And and i was i I learned a little bit about it. It's the roguelike ROM hack thing, right? Yeah, i'll give you I'll give you a quick rundown. So it was somebody decided to make roguelike permadeath rules for Pokemon.
00:17:45
Speaker
And it got the name Nuzlocke because they had a Nuzleaf. They were they were like doing a webcomic drawing their journey and they drew the Nuzleaf's face like Locke from Lost. So that's how this custom rule set became. That's why it's known Nuzlocke. But I mean, it's been called the Nuzlocke for, I don't know, 15 years or something like that now. Like it's been around for a long time and I've done Nuzlocke in Pokemon and they're super fun. So the the key rules are you can only catch the first Pokemon you run into it in a given location.
00:18:17
Speaker
So random, you don't know who you're going to get. You might end up with a shitty Pokemon on your team and tough luck because you don't get any more from that location. And then Pokemon are a limited resource because the other custom rule is if your Pokemon faints, it's dead. You can never use it again.
00:18:31
Speaker
you either have to release it or put it in a box or trade it to another game. You can never use it again on that run. That's more realistic. Yeah, right? ah You win if you make it to the Elite Four and beat them or whatever arbitrary goal you set.
00:18:44
Speaker
You lose if you run out of Pokemon. um And has this really funny effect of making you, like... bond with your Pokémon more. And so there's all kinds of custom rules people do to make it easier or harder, whatever. A very common rule is you have to nickname your Pokémon. And I think that's to lean into like the emotional aspect of it. like ah You get attached to these little critters that you've never used before.

And this is what we came up with as the core. If you lose the game, any cards that are from your deck that are left on the board are dead. You can never use them again. um I mean, for the rest of your run to infinite, that's when you win, if you if you get to infinite. Ah, okay.
00:20:08
Speaker
Retreating is not losing. That just is would be impractical, and this seems more snappy, right? That you can retreat to save your to save your cards. um And then I added, you must name your decks.
